0 reports about 2412904588The number was first reported 4th Aug, 2025
Received a phone call from 2412904588? Report here
File a report about 2412904588 |
Phone Number Variations: 2412904588, 0241-2904588, 912412904588, 002412904588, 1912412904588, +1912412904588